问题标签 [unrar]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
3 回答
2920 浏览

python - 下载时解压缩存档

我有一个程序下载part01,然后part02等rar文件在互联网上拆分。我的程序先下载part01,然后下载part02,以此类推。经过一些测试,我发现使用例如 UnRAR2 for python 我可以提取存档中包含的文件的第一部分(一个 .avi 文件),并且可以在最初的几分钟内播放它。当我添加另一个文件时,它会提取更多内容,依此类推。我想知道的是:是否可以在下载单个文件时提取它们?我需要它来开始提取 part01 而不必等待它完成下载......这可能吗?

非常感谢你!

马泰奥

0 投票
1 回答
1352 浏览

applescript - Applescript Noob,解压缩 .rar 文件并移动包含文件

我以前从未接触过苹果脚本,我只需要 1 个小脚本,但不知道从哪里开始。

我想要做的就是在文件夹操作上运行一个脚本..

当我将 aa rar 文件放在文件夹中时基本上运行。仅当它是电影文件时才需要解压缩然后将文件移动到另一个文件夹?

这可能吗 ??

谢谢

0 投票
1 回答
555 浏览

bash - 用于多归档 unrar 的 bash 函数/别名

我正在尝试编写一个简单的 bash 别名/函数(无论哪个我工作得最快),以解开多 rar 档案。我的尝试都没有奏效。

在 shell 中调用的普通命令也不起作用,我猜这可能是问题的要旨:

该命令的 find 部分似乎可以正常工作,尽管 -exec 似乎根本没有被调用。

谢谢!

0 投票
2 回答
1036 浏览

batch-file - 将 unrar.exe 的输出记录到文本文件(批处理脚本)

我正在编写一个提取文件的批处理脚本,现在想将 unrar.exe 的输出记录到文本文件中。我想到的输出是由于档案损坏等导致的失败,或者只是操作成功。

关于如何解决这个问题的任何想法?

提前致谢!

0 投票
1 回答
1009 浏览

linux - perl 解压文件

我希望 perl 从我指定的文件夹中解压缩文件,然后删除稀有文件,这样它们就不会使用 HDD 空间。文件可以采用以下格式: (r(ar|[0-9][0-9])|sfv)

我已经安装了 unrar,而且我是 PERL 的新手,所以如果我需要在某处添加一些东西,请具体说明。就像在文件顶部添加这个和这个一样。

我的脚本现在是这样的:

谢谢

//哦,是的,有时可能会有一个包含多个部分的 rar 文件的文件夹,称为 .r01、.r02 .. .r50,所有这些部分实际上是 1 个大 rar 文件分成许多部分

0 投票
3 回答
3311 浏览

iphone - 是否有适用于 iOS 的 unrar 库?

我想在我的 iphone 应用程序中包含一个 unrar 文件选项。

我已经尝试过https://github.com/ararog/Unrar4iOS但是这个库不完整(一些功能还没有实现,比如 -(BOOL) unrarFileTo:(NSString*)path overWrite:(BOOL)overwrite)

谢谢。

0 投票
1 回答
1892 浏览

linux - 在 Linux 中使用 unrar 命令对存档进行深度解压缩

我使用以下命令将 rar-acrhive 中的所有文件解压缩到一个目录

它工作得很好,它忽略了档案中的目录结构,这正是我想要的。

如果有的话,我如何使它解压缩存档中的所有 rar 文件?

0 投票
1 回答
397 浏览

python - 如何使用 UnRAR2 Python lib 获取非稀有文件的名称?

我正在使用 python UnRar2 文件来解压缩一个文件,但是在我这样做之后,我想要它被解压缩到的目录的名称。是否可以使用 Unrar2 lib 获取该信息,如果可以,请告诉我如何操作?

谢谢,

帕思

编辑:对不起,我的意思是当你提取 rar 时,它会创建一个包含 rar 内容的文件夹(在我的情况下,这总是正确的)。我想知道如何获取该文件夹的名称。

0 投票
1 回答
342 浏览

python - 如何使用 pyUnrar2 获取提取的目录?

我正在使用 pyUnrar2 批量提取 rar 文件,我想获取的是文件提取后所在目录的名称?

0 投票
2 回答
3866 浏览

c# - 无法加载 DLL 'UNRAR.DLL':找不到指定的模块

我刚刚从http://www.rarlab.com/rar_add.htm下载了 UnRAR.dll包包括 C# 示例项目,当我在选择 .rar 文件进行提取后在 VS 2010 中运行时,我收到以下错误消息

无法加载“UNRAR.DLL”

当我添加参考 unrar.dll 我得到以下错误

unrar.dll 无法加载

请帮助/指出我缺少什么?